Your role: The Sun is looking for a talented individual to help lead the development of The Sun’s SEO strategy in a world of AI.

Day to day you will: 

  • Help to grow organic search, Discover and Google News visibility across platforms on all four of The Sun’s domains – thesun.co.uk / the-sun.com / thescottishsun.co.uk / thesun.ie
  • Optimise The Sun’s content across platforms for large language models
  • Help to drive sign-ups to The Sun Club (The Sun’s premium content offering)
  • Communicate with the newsroom on big breaking stories
  • Be a point of contact for journalists and editors seeking SEO advice and insight
  • Contribute to The Sun’s trending output (pitching and writing content as required)
  • Contribute to The Sun’s live blog strategy
  • Contribute to The Sun’s forward planning strategy
  • Contribute to SEO strategy for specific sections
  • Analyse and report back to the newsroom on SEO performance and strategy
  • Perform competitor analysis and identify opportunities to improve and overtake in key markets
  • Be aware of key developments within SEO and LLM optimisation

What we’re looking for from you:

  • Strong understanding of daily news trends, as well as what is working long-term
  • Good relationships and strong communication with the different section heads
  • Be agile: Fast-moving and quick to flag emerging and declining trends
  • Ability to implement ideas and strategies to help overall traffic growth
  • Understanding of SEO tools in the newsroom and ability to use them to maximum effect
  • Passion for news and digital journalism is a must
  • A background in digital journalism would be preferred
  • Good team player
  • Technical SEO knowledge would be a bonus
